Randy Crow
Randell Willard “Randy” Crow, 78, passed away Sunday, September 28, 2025 at his home.
Born April 3, 1947 in Spartanburg, he was a son of the late Dillard Hicks Crow and Nellie Scruggs Yelton Crow. He proudly served our country in the U.S. Army, was a former construction working and of the Baptist faith.
Surviving is his son, Benjamin Crow of Inman; sisters, Debbie Brown of Gaffney, Barbara Towery of Chesnee; brothers, Ken Yelton of Chesnee, Boyce Crow of Columbia; grandchildren, Tristan Hood, Nicholas Hood; great-grandchildren, Ashlyn Powers and Kace Powers.
In addition to his parents, he was predeceased by a daughter, Kelly Arledge; sister, Sylvia Childers; brothers, Marshall Yelton and Roger Crow.
Graveside services with military honors will be 2:00 p.m. Wednesday, October 8, 2025 at M.J. Dolly Cooper Veterans Cemetery in Anderson.
Family members are at their respective homes.
